Here’s another amazing micro house build on a Japanese truck bed! While I don’t know the exact measurements of this truck, many Suzuki truck beds are 6.5 x 4.5 feet, meaning this micro house is around just 30 square feet — now that’s tiny.

Below, you can watch a time-lapse of the entire build, or skip to the last 10 minutes to see most of the finished product. The home is solar-powered and has running water, a fan, and a built-in countertop/eating area. There’s even a mini stove to make rice on.
